TN SB 925

enacted

Taxes, Sales - As enacted, sets the end date at June 30, 2027, for the exemption from sales and use tax for purchases and leases of equipment and infrastructure used to produce broadband communications services or provide internet access. - Amends TCA Title 67, Chapter 6, Part 3.
